If g(x) = x3 - 5 and h(x) = 2x - 2, find g(h(3))

g(h(3)) simply means g of h of 3
mathematically represented as:
h(3)=2(3)-2 which gives 4
you then substitute 4 with X in g(x)
we then have g(h(3)) where h(3)=4 and X is also =h(3) as
g(4)=4^3-5
=59
